Octavia vRS: Reset CEL, now some electronics not working!

Need help guys! last night i used a bluetooth OBDII scanner to reset the CEL,and went to sleep, today morning, as i took the car out on road, the horn,turn indicators,ac blower, windshield wipers were not functioning, i checked the fuse box, they're fine. can anyone please throw some light?

1) P0012 - "A" Camshaft Position - Timing Over-Retarded (Bank 1)

What does that mean?

-> A code P0012 refers to the VVT (variable valve timing) or VCT (variable camshaft timing) components and the car's PCM (powertrain control module, also called an ECM). That consists of a few different components but the P0012 DTC specifically refers to the camshaft (cam) timing. In this case, if the cam timing is over-retarded, the engine light will be illluminated and the code will be set. The "A" camshaft is either the intake, left, or front camshaft.

Potential Symptoms

-> Most likely a P0012 DTC will result in one of the following: hard starting poor idle and/or stalling There are potentially other symptoms as well. Of course, when trouble codes are set, the MIL (malfunction indicator lamp, a.k.a. the check engine light) illuminates.

Causes

-> A P0012 DTC trouble code may be caused by one or more of the following: Incorrect camshaft timing Wiring problems (harness/wiring) in intake timing control valve control solenoid system Continuous oil flow to VCT piston chamber Failed timing valve control solenoid (stuck open)

Possible Solutions

-> The main thing to check is to verify the operation of the VCT solenoid. You're looking for a sticking or stuck VCT solenoid valve caused by contamination. Refer to vehicle specific repair manual to perform component tests for the VCT unit. Notes: Dealer techs have advanced tools and the ability to follow detailed troubleshooting steps, including the ability to test components using a scan tool.

---------------------------------------------------------------------------

2) P1296 - Cooling system malfunction

Not much information on this code as it is manufacturer specific.

Just try and change the coolant temperature sensor and check if the codes are displayed again.

problem solved, thank you all for your valued comments, the problem was solved by a local mechanic in my small city, he said he's solved the same problem in around 11 - 12 octys. the problem was somewhere behind the ignition switch, he opened the whole steering and did something inside it, he told my driver that he has installed two Tata Safari relays (!) and everything should be fine now. I was not present there, hence very brief explanation, but if someone else finds the same faults, I'll be more than happy to help. thanks
